Executable program/pt

From Lazarus wiki
Jump to navigationJump to search
The printable version is no longer supported and may have rendering errors. Please update your browser bookmarks and please use the default browser print function instead.

Deutsch (de) English (en) suomi (fi) français (fr) Bahasa Indonesia (id) polski (pl) português (pt) русский (ru)

Um programa executável é a tradução de código-fonte (no nosso caso, Pascal) por um compilador (ou código-fonte em linguagem assembly que é traduzido por um assembler) em um arquivo-objeto, que tem de ser combinado com as units (unidades) Pascal necessárias, a biblioteca de tempo-de-execução Pascal e quaisquer outros arquivos-objetos que tenham sido escritos por terceiros, para produzir o programa binário em questão que pode

  • ser executado diretamente pelo sistema operacional como uma aplicação,
  • ser usado pelo sistema operacional, tal como os drivers de dispositivos, ou
  • tornar-se parte do sistema operacional em si.